المساعد الشخصي الرقمي

مشاهدة النسخة كاملة : [ الدرس مفصل الحادي عشر ] شرح طريقة جميع أوامر الـ fscommand الأساسية



loulou ange
10-30-2013, بتوقيت غرينيتش 07:08 PM
السلام عليكم ورحمة الله


هذه الدروس إجتهاد شخصي مني فإن أصبت فمن الله



وإن أخطأت فمني ومن الشيطان .


[ الدرس مفصل الحادي عشر ] شرح طريقة جميع أوامر الـ fscommand



الأمر fscommand هو :


يستخدم هذا الأمر للتحكم في مشغل الملفات Flash Player , وعند اختيار هذا الأمر تظهر المتغيرات الخاصة به ،
و يتح لك إرسال الأوامر من الافلام فلاش الى دالات جافا سكربيت الموجودة على صفحة الويب .


شرح طريقة لمعطيات هذا الأمر بالترتيب :

أولاً

Quit

وتعني الخروج

طريقة العمل :

افتح عمل جديد

اعمل زر

افتح نافذة الأكشن

وضع أمر الضغط العادي للأزرار ( press ) . ثم أضف الأمر fscommand

واختر من هذه القائمة الأمر Quit

http://www.dzbatna.info/dzbatna1/DR_11_1.gif

وفي خانة Argument أسفل اكتب true

http://www.dzbatna.info/dzbatna1/DR_11_TRUE.gif

و كتبنا true لتأكيد أمر الإغلاق

فيصبح لديك زر عليه مثل هذا الكود code

رمز Code:
on (press) { fscommand("Quit","true"); }

==================================================
××××××××××××××××××××××××××××××××××××××××××××××××××
==================================================

ثانيًا

FullScreen

وتعني إمتلاء الصفحة

طريقة العمل :

افتح عمل جديد

اعمل زر

افتح نافذة الأكشن

وضع أمر الضغط العادي للأزرار ( press ) . ثم أضف الأمر fscommand

واختر من هذه القائمة الأمر FullScreen

http://www.dzbatna.info/dzbatna1/DR_11_1.gif

وفي خانة Argument أسفل اكتب true

http://www.dzbatna.info/dzbatna1/DR_11_TRUE.gif

و كتبنا true لتأكيد أمتلاء الصفحة

فيصبح لديك زر عليه مثل هذا الكود code


رمز Code:
on (press) { fscommand("FullScreen","true"); }
وإذا تريد أن يكون الأمر مفعلاً عندما يبدأ العمل دون الحاجة إلى الضغط على زر
تعطيه أمر onFrame أي يصبح الكود code هكذا :

رمز Code:
onFrame (1) { fscommand("FullScreen","true"); }
تريد إلغاء هذا الأمر

اعمل زر مثل الذي عملته قبل قليل ثم اكتب نفس الكود code ولكن في خانة Argument

بدل كلمة true اكتب كلمة false

فيكون لديك هذا الكود code


رمز Code:
on (press) { fscommand("FullScreen","false"); }


==================================================
××××××××××××××××××××××××××××××××××××××××××××××××××
==================================================

ثالثًا

AllowScale

وتعني إعادة العمل لحجمه الطبيعي

طريقة العمل :

افتح عمل جديد

اعمل زر

افتح نافذة الأكشن

وضع أمر الضغط العادي للأزرار ( press ) . ثم أضف الأمر fscommand

واختر من هذه القائمة الأمر AllowScale

http://www.dzbatna.info/dzbatna1/DR_11_1.gif


و لم نكتب true أو false وذلك لعدم فائدة وجودها في هذا الأمر

فيصبح لديك زر عليه مثل هذا الكود code

رمز Code:
on (press) { fscommand("AllowScale"); }

==================================================
××××××××××××××××××××××××××××××××××××××××××××××××××
==================================================

رابعًا

ShowMenu

وتعني إعادة العمل لحجمه الطبيعي

طريقة العمل :

افتح عمل جديد

ادخل على السين الرئيسي Scene

افتح نافذة الأكشن

وضع أمر عند الفريم ( on frame ) عن طريقة Events > Frame > onFrame

ثم أضف الأمر fscommand

واختر من هذه القائمة الأمر ShowMenu

http://www.dzbatna.info/dzbatna1/DR_11_FALSE.gif


و كتبنا false لتأكيد عدم ظهور القائمة


فيصبح لديك زر عليه مثل هذا الكود code


رمز Code:
onFrame (1) { fscommand("ShowMenu","false"); }

و لإبطال عمل الكود code بدل كلمة false اكتب كلمة true


أما عن الأمر Exec فراح نتطرق له في درس مفصل آخر بإذن الله.



التطبيق /

عمل زر واحد لكل أمر ووضعه في عمل واحد ورفعه بالمرفقات .


وإلى هنا نكون قد انتهينا من أوامر الـ fscommand




محبكم /


فلاشين



الملفات المرفقة
http://www.traidnt.net/vb/images/attach/zip.gif الدرس الحادي عشر.zip (http://www.traidnt.net/vb/attachments/165677d1187554297-الدرس-الحادي-عشر.zip) (2.2 كيلوبايت, عدد مرات المشاهدة 279 مرة)


https://fbcdn-sphotos-d-a.akamaihd.net/hphotos-ak-ash4/482113_236967293114455_1193518507_n.png (http://www.dzbatna.com)
©المشاركات المنشورة تعبر عن وجهة نظر صاحبها فقط، ولا تُعبّر بأي شكل من الأشكال عن وجهة نظر إدارة المنتدى (http://www.dzbatna.com)©

استعمل مربع البحث في الاسفل لمزيد من المواضيع


سريع للبحث عن مواضيع في المنتدى